Job Description:

Lead Technician - Oxley £48,991 + 12.5% shift allowance
Days & Nights
Permanent Contract

Your new role:

Hitachi Rail is seeking a dedicated Lead Technician to join our Train care Centre in Oxley, Midlands.

In this exciting role, you will play a key part in ensuring the reliability, safety, and performance of Hitachi's rolling stock fleet of 805/7. The successful candidate will be responsible for carrying out complex fault diagnosis, maintenance, MOD programmes and repairs on rolling stock assets, ensuring they are maintained to the highest operational and safety standards.

Working within a skilled team environment, you will provide technical expertise, support reliability improvements, and contribute to the delivery of a safe and dependable railway Avanti West Coast service.

As a Lead Technician at Hitachi Rail's Oxley Train care Centre, you will be responsible for ensuring the safe, reliable, and efficient operation of rolling stock through advanced maintenance, fault diagnosis, repair, and technical support activities.

Work-life balance supported through a shift pattern that includes two weekends off per month.

Maintenance & Engineering

  • Carry out planned and reactive maintenance on rolling stock assets.
  • Remove, replace, assemble, modify, and install components using approved engineering techniques.
  • Read and interpret technical drawings, specifications, and maintenance documentation.
  • Ensure rolling stock complies with operational and engineering requirements.

Fault Finding & Reliability

  • Diagnose and rectify complex electrical and mechanical faults.
  • Investigate recurring defects and implement effective corrective actions.
  • Support reliability improvement initiatives to enhance fleet performance.
  • Provide technical assistance during in-service failures and operational incidents.

Technical Leadership

  • Develop technical scopes of work with the aid of engineering for fault rectification activities.
  • Liaise with internal departments and external stakeholders to resolve technical issues.

Safety, Quality & Compliance

  • Maintain a safe, clean, and efficient working environment.
  • Comply with all health, safety, environmental, and quality standards.
  • Ensure tools, equipment, and materials are maintained and used correctly.

Administration & Continuous Improvement

  • Maintain accurate maintenance records within SAP.
  • Build effective working relationships across teams.
  • Develop new skills and technical knowledge in line with business requirements.
  • Undertake additional duties as required to support local operational needs.

About you:

Qualifications

  • HNC or Served apprenticeship with mechanical, electrical disciplines or Engineering based NVQ Level 3.

Behavioral

  • Strong understanding of and adherence to railway rules, regulations, and safety standards.
  • Good written and verbal communication skills.
  • Professional and positive representative of Hitachi Rail.
  • Effective team player with a collaborative approach.
  • Proactive problem-solver with a strong safety focus.
  • Adaptable and committed to continuous learning and development.

Desirable

  • Network Rail Sentinel PTS
  • Stock-Specific maintenance and faulting
  • Depot Protection
  • Working at Height
  • Manual Handling
  • Powered plant and tools – air / 110v
  • Crimping competence & assessment
  • Intermediate IT skills – typically Word, Excel
  • AC Depot isolation
  • Moveable plant
  • Driving License
